M28W160CT, M28W160CB  
SIGNAL DESCRIPTIONS  
See Figure 2 Logic Diagram and Table 2,Signal  
Names, for a brief overview of the signals connect-  
ed to this device.  
Address Inputs (A0-A19). The Address Inputs  
select the cells in the memory array to access dur-  
ing Bus Read operations. During Bus Write opera-  
tions they control the commands sent to the  
Command Interface of the internal state machine.  
Data Input/Output (DQ0-DQ15). The Data I/O  
outputs the data stored at the selected address  
during a Bus Read operation or inputs a command  
or the data to be programmed during a Write Bus  
operation.

Output Enable (G). The Output Enable controls  
data outputs during the Bus Read operation of the  
memory.  
Write Enable (W). The Write Enable controls the  
Bus Write operation of the memory’s Command  
Interface. The data and address inputs are latched  
on the rising edge of Chip Enable, E, or Write En-  
able, W, whichever occurs first.
